/* Note: fdlib.c contains a function local_time_to_utc that converts a
+
* time_t containing local time to a real one (i.e. UTC). It might be
+
* generally useful but is so far slightly MS specific, which is why
+
* it still resides in fdlib.c. (It just needs some more of the usual
+
* HAVE_XYZ configure test hoopla.) */
